Tested http://www.phphq.net/?script=phPhotoAlbum
on my website. Works as advertised. Put phPhotoAlbum.php in a folder, put folder named album below that, copy jpg or gif files to album folder, point your browser to phPhotoAlbum.php. Subfolders under album can be created and files uploaded from the admin login. Simplicity personified!
